Eternity simply means life without end. Eternity is a place of no return; hence, where you will spend eternity should matter to you. Eternity can either be spent in heaven or hell. Matthew 25:46 says, “And these shall go away into everlasting punishment: but the righteous into life eternal.”

The way you lived your life before you die will determine your place in eternity. It is often said that you cannot eat your cake and still have it. This means that, you cannot live your life throughout in sin and expect to go to heaven on the last day. 1 Corinthians 6: 9- 10 says, “Know ye not that the unrighteous shall not inherit the kingdom of God? Be not deceived: neither fornicators, nor idolators, nor adulterers, nor effeminate, nor abusers of themselves with mankind, nor thieves, nor covetous, nor drunkards, nor revilers, nor extortioners, shall inherit the kingdom of God.” In the same vein, Revelation 21: 27 says, “And there shall in no wise enter into it any thing that defileth, neither whatsoever worketh abomination, or maketh a lie: but they which are written in the Lamb’s book of life.”
